<named-content content-type="genus-species">Yersinia pestis</named-content> Subverts the Dermal Neutrophil Response in a Mouse Model of Bubonic Plague

ABSTRACT The majority of human Yersinia pestis infections result from introduction of bacteria into the skin by the bite of an infected flea.
